Abstract In this work, a ternary composite of epoxy filled with ND and MS was produced for abrasive applications.Surfactants (oleic acid (OA), sodium dodecyl sulfate (SDS) and Triton TX-100 (TX-100)) were used to improve the particle dispersion and, consequently, the composite properties.The elastic modulus Outdoor Swivel Chair w/Cushion (set of 2) increased up to 76% for the sample with 1 wt% ND and 5 wt% ND using TX-100 (1ND5MS-TX100).Regardless of the filler concentration, the particles did not modify the thermal degradation behavior of the epoxy.Thermogravimetric (TGA) and dynamic mechanical (DMA) analyses suggest a strong Nail Care Kit particle-matrix interface, also evidenced in scanning electron microscope (SEM) micrographs.
The composites presented superior tribological performance.1ND5MS-TX100 presented a wear rate of 2.19 x 10-3 mm3.Nm-1, 61.3% lower than the epoxy.
Also, all composites significantly reduced the roughness of the marble, being proportional to the abrasives concentration.Overall, composites with TX-100 presented improved wear behavior.
